In an unregulated airgun, the velocity of the projectile drops as the pressure in the reservoir decreases. This creates a "velocity curve" that affects long-range accuracy.Modern pneumatic airguns solve this with a . A regulator acts as a gatekeeper, taking high-pressure air from the main tank and metering it down to a lower, precise "plenum pressure" for each shot. This ensures that whether your tank is completely full or nearing empty, every pellet or slug leaves the barrel at the exact same speed. The earliest known pneumatic airguns date back to the 16th and 17th centuries. The most famous historical example is the Girardoni air rifle, used by the Austrian army in the late 18th century and famously carried by Lewis and Clark on their American expedition. These early models relied on large, hand-pumped reservoirs and required significant effort to pressurise, but they offered a smokeless, quiet alternative to black powder firearms. The modern pneumatic airgun represents a pinnacle of precision engineering, blending centuries-old concepts with cutting-edge materials and physics. Unlike traditional spring-piston air rifles, which rely on a heavy coiled spring and mechanical piston to compress air at the moment of firing, pneumatic airguns utilize pre-compressed air stored in an onboard reservoir. This fundamental shift in propulsion mechanics eliminates the violent bi-directional recoil characteristic of springers, offering shooters unparalleled accuracy, consistency, and power.
